I have a 72 Bow-front Reef/Fish tank. A custom made 20 gallon sump with rubble and Cheato by Custom King. I have a Bermuda skimmer run by an Eheim 1260 pump. Works great! 100 lbs. of great live rock. I use 4" filter socks, which I replace every other day. I have a Mag 7 as my return pump. I have a 48" Maristar 2x250 Metal Halides with 2 48" Actinics. I run a Phosban reactor. I have plenty of coral, 3 small clams, a Foxface, 2 Ocellarus clowns, 2 Sand Sifting Gobies, a Potters Angel, and a Christmas Wrasse. All fish are small. I've cut down my feeding, and I do 20 gallon water changes weekly. I use RO/Di water. I use Tropic Marin Reef salt. Salinity is 1.024. All my parameters are good, except nitrates! I checked today with a Salifert kit, and they were at 5 ppm The only possible culprit is the cheato I added a few weeks ago. Any thoughts?

Your good, 5ppm is nothing to worry about. I have had a 30 gallon reef loaded with corals and few small fish, nitrates fluxed around 5 to 20 ppm (depending when I did a water change) and all corals were super healthy and growing. 5 is nothing to worry about, the more you focus and perfect water parameters it kinda takes away of actually enjoying your aquarium and the hobby itself.
